Jaguar 'to create 2,000 jobs'
Resurgent car maker Jaguar Land Rover is poised to confirm this week that it will build a £400m engine plant in the British Midlands that will create up to 2,000 jobs, it was reported today.
JLR could announce the engine plant as early as Monday alongside Business Secretary Vince Cable after securing financial support from the British government, according to the Sunday Telegraph.
